The Villanova Wildcats will host the Army Black Knights as part of next season’s non-conference schedule per Jon Rothstein of CBS Sports:
Source: Villanova will host Army as part of its 19-20 non-conference schedule.

Army finished the 2019 season 13-19, and tied with Navy for 5th in the Patriot League. They finished the season ranked 242nd in KenPom, and were much better on defense than they were offensively. But don’t let that fool you, Army can hang with some of the better teams if given the opportunity. You actually may have caught them on TV when they gave Duke an early season scare before Zion Williamson and company pulled away late.
The Black Knights will return both of their leading scorers next season in current juniors in Matt Wilson and Tommy Funk. Wilson is a 6’9” forward that can both score and pass in the paint, while Funk is a threat to shoot from deep or penetrate the defense.
This now leaves just two unknown non-con games on the Wildcats 2019-20 schedule, as Villanova will also face Kansas, UConn, the Big 5, and participate in the Myrtle Beach Invitational.
